MEMO — Warranty Cost Overrun, Brindlecore Series

Warranty claims on the Brindlecore 400 line are running 38% over forecast, driven by seal failures from the Haverlock plant batch. Reserve topped up this quarter; margin impact flagged to group finance. Root-cause review due in two weeks. Heads of department: hold all related external statements. The confidential note on business plans sits immediately below.

management briefing: Gross margin on Ralael came in at 15 percent against a plan of 10 percent. Only 9 of the 100 pilot accounts renewed Ralael, so a churn review is set for April 1.

MEMO — Kettling Depot Receiving

Uniform sets for the new Kettling depot arrive Wednesday via Ashgrove courier: 40 boxes, sorted by size, manifest attached to box one. Check the count at the dock before signing; shortages go straight to stores, not the courier. The hand-over instruction the courier will follow is set out below.

drop instructions, tafof-baguf: the holmir gilox courier leaves the sormir ulaok holdor ledger at gate 5596 under passcode 257343

Q3 Planning Note — Warranty Costs

Sales leads: warranty claims on the Kestrel 40 pump line ran 18% over budget this quarter, driven mainly by seal failures in units shipped from the Branmore plant. Repair turnaround is now averaging nine days, and Halvex Industries has flagged the delay in two renewal conversations. Quote margins on Kestrel deals should assume the higher accrual rate until engineering confirms the revised seal supplier. Before briefing your teams, note the following.

internal memo for kahop-yajof: The steering committee signed off on a budget of $12.6 million for Project Jorwyn. The renewal with Quenoxox Logistics closes at $16.8 million a year, 48 percent above the last contract.

Subject: Lockerloop access flow cut-over complete

Plugin authors — as of this morning, Lockerloop's laundry-locker access flow runs entirely on the v3 token handshake. The legacy PIN-only path is disabled; plugins that still call it will receive a deprecation error rather than a silent fallback. Unlock latency is down noticeably, and retry semantics are unchanged. Please retest your integrations against the sandbox this week. The sandbox environment now runs with the values listed below.

config for tafog-kagef:
oliwyn:
  log_level: info
  metrics_host: metrics.oliwyn.qorvellabs.internal
  pool_size: 16